Why Rochester Hills’s Climate & Housing Affect Gate Repair
Rochester Hills presents a nearly perfect storm of gate-killing conditions that contractors from warmer climates simply don’t encounter. Michigan’s 42-inch frost depth requirement means gate posts are set deep, but the heavy clay soils across Oakland County expand and contract violently through freeze-thaw cycles. By March, we’ve taken hundreds of calls from Rochester Hills homeowners whose gates have been scraping concrete since January - the post heaved, the frame twisted, and the operator strained until it faulted out.
The calcium chloride ice melt used on Rochester Hills driveways and roads accelerates corrosion at hinge welds and latch mechanisms. And the Paint Creek corridor creates a drainage zone where subdivisions on lower terrain see buried post stubs rotting from the inside out. An experienced technician checks the buried post before quoting any repair in these areas, because surface rust alone understates the structural damage. The ornamental iron and aluminum gates specified by Rochester Hills HOAs twenty to forty years ago are handsome, but they’re entering simultaneous end-of-life for operators, hinges, and structural hardware. Replacement gates must clear architectural review, which adds a compliance layer that most surrounding communities don’t impose. Pricing for Gate Repair in Rochester Hills
We settle on an upfront price before turning a single bolt. No surprises on the bill.
| Service |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Hinge weld or latch adjustment | $180 - $280 |
| Operator reset or limit switch repair | $220 - $340 |
| Post re-plumbing after frost heave | $380 - $650 |
| Full operator replacement (installed) | $1,200 - $2,400 |
| $89 Seasonal Tune-Up | $89 flat |
